About Sunil Kumar Khatkar

Sunil Kumar Khatkar is a scholar working on Food Science, Nutrition and Dietetics, Molecular Biology, Animal Science and Zoology and Biomaterials, having authored 35 papers that have together received 714 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Proteins in Food Systems (16 papers), Food composition and properties (12 papers), Microencapsulation and Drying Processes (9 papers), Meat and Animal Product Quality (5 papers), Food Quality and Safety Studies (4 papers), Food Chemistry and Fat Analysis (4 papers), Probiotics and Fermented Foods (4 papers) and Freezing and Crystallization Processes (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Food Science (513 citations), Animal Science and Zoology (135 citations), Biochemistry (65 citations), Nutrition and Dietetics (165 citations) and Biotechnology (60 citations). Sunil Kumar Khatkar has collaborated with scholars based in India, Türkiye and United States. Frequent co-authors include Anju Boora Khatkar, Amarjeet Kaur, Nitin Mehta, Gurkirat Kaur, Neha Sharma, Anil Panghal, Navnidhi Chhikara, Vijay K. Gupta, Yogesh Gat and Neelesh Sindhu. Their work appears in journals such as International Journal of Food Science & Technology, Journal of Food Science and Technology, Journal of Food Processing and Preservation, LWT and Food Research International.
